Midol Complete and Singulair (Montelukast Chewable Tablets)
Determining the interaction of Midol Complete and Singulair (Montelukast Chewable Tablets) and the possibility of their joint administration.
No interaction was detected between the selected drugs or effects of joint drug administration are currently understudied, and it takes time and accumulated statistics to determine their interaction. A doctor should be consulted to address the issue of joint drug administration.
Generic Name: acetaminophen / caffeine / pyrilamine
Brand name: GoodSense Menstrual Relief, Midol Complete
Synonyms: n.a.
Generic Name: montelukast
Brand name: Singulair
Synonyms: Singulair
